In a message dated 00-12-01 05:58:00 EST, Jim Harp Writes:
<< For the past few years Cambridge Camera in New
York has had quite a few Ricoh XR-10Ms (used, returned, remainders?)
available for between $125-180, but I have the sense that their supply of
Ricohs in good condition is diminishing. >>
It has become increasingly difficult to find good Richos at Cambridge. I
used to be able to go in and go through the Richos and find 3 or 4 good ones
in a matter of half an hour. I did this every so often for myself and others
without any problem. I went a few weeks ago to find one for Jim Harp and it
took me quite a while and quite a number of cameras to find a decent one.
Some problems are cosmetic, others are functional, but the days of finding 3
- 4 are over. I think you need at least 3 to cover yourself. I would
recommend 4 or 5. Best bet is now to find them at camera shows, but they
rarely show up there. I go to 2 major camera shows a month and once in a
while I will see one for sale - usually for about $150 or so. Maybe eBay
will prove to be a source. It is a great system, reliable, lenses are easy
to find(Pentax K-mount) and cheap, and hypers are a snap. Good luck to
anyone looking.
